PHTHALOCYANINE DYE COMPOUNDS, CONJUGATES AND METHODS OF USE THEREOF
20220010140 · 2022-01-13 ·

Disclosed herein are phthalocyanine dyes, and conjugates thereof, useful as fluorescent reporters for bioassays, for optical imaging and as therapeutic conjugates as the photosensitizing agents in light-based therapies including photoimmuno therapy (PIT). Certain phthalocyanine dyes disclosed herein are water soluble, and possess photophysical and photochemical profiles useful for use in imaging or therapy.

THREE-DIMENSIONAL DYE, MANUFACTURING METHOD OF THREE-DIMENSIONAL DYE AND PHOTORESIST MIXTURE

A three-dimensional dye, a manufacturing method of the three-dimensional dye, and a photoresist mixture are disclosed. A non-planar three-dimensional dye molecular structure is constructed by adding a three-dimensional structure group into a dye molecule, thereby breaking the strong attraction force between the planar conjugation of the dye molecule. Aggregation of dye molecules are prevented, influence of dye molecules on optical paths is eliminated, and thus optical properties and color rendering properties of color filters made by a photoresist liquid are improved.

COLORING COMPOSITION, FILM, COLOR FILTER, SOLID-STATE IMAGING ELEMENT, AND IMAGE DISPLAY DEVICE

Provided are a coloring composition including a colorant, a polymerizable compound, and a photopolymerization initiator, in which the colorant includes a green pigment, a content of the green pigment in a total solid content of the coloring composition is 25% by mass or more, and the green pigment includes a compound which is a compound represented by Formula (1) and has a maximal absorption wavelength in a wavelength range of 620 to 730 nm; a film formed of the coloring composition; a color filter; a solid-state imaging element; and an image display device.
